News from the 28.01.2007 Swiss Film Prize 2007
We´re pleased to announce that the entire ensemble of Stina Werenfels´ film GOING PRIVATE (Nachbeben) were awarded the Jury Prize at this years´ Swiss Film Prize ceremony in Solothurn. We would like to congratulate Michael Neuenschwander, Susanne-Marie Wrage, Leonardo Nigro, Georg Scharegg, Bettina Stucky, Olivia Frolich and the director Stina Werenfels.
The jury consisted of: Charles Lewinsky (author), Catherine Ann Berger (script consultant and critic), Sabine Gisiger (director), Frédéric Guillaume (animation filmmaker), Noémie Kocher (actress), Pierre-Alan Meier (director/producer) and Serge Sobczynski (programmer Cannes Film Festival).

News from the 31.10.2006 Zurich Film Prize
The Council of the City of Zurich has this year awarded the Zurich Film Prize to GOING PRIVATE (Nachbeben) (20'000 Swiss Francs). Werenfels’ film is an atmospherically dense depiction of the mores of a stratum of society, a stratum which thanks to the New Economy achieved wealth fast but paid for its upward mobility with a loss of human relationships. |

News from the 08.05.2006 GOING PRIVATE (Nachbeben) wins the NDR-Directors' Prize at Schwerin Filmkunst Festival
After GOING PRIVATE (Nachbeben) ) was seen by 25'000 viewers in swiss cinemas, (with only 6 Prints), and won the Best Film accolade at Viareggio, the jury at the Filmkunstfest in Schwerin also awarded Stina Werenfels the prize for best direction, awarded to her by the NDR. |

News from the 05.01.2006 Premiere at the Solothurn Film Festival
Im Mittelpunkt der 41. Solothurner Filmtage steht einmal mehr die Vorjahresproduktion des Schweizerischen Filmschaffens aus allen vier Sprachregionen sowie der im Ausland arbeitenden Schweizer Filmschaffenden. Daneben präsentieren verschiedene Sonderprogramme neue und überraschende Einblicke in die Vielfalt der Schweizer Filmkultur. Die 41. Solothurner Filmtage werden am 16. Januar 2006 von Bundespräsident Moritz Leuenberger und Ivo Kummer, Direktor der Solothurner Filmtage, eröffnet. Zur Eröffnung gelangt der Spielfilm GOING PRIVATE (Nachbeben) von Stina Werenfels zur Uraufführung. |
